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59862617 18344522 64944 98572 324
03416603363 179 44343822685
03416603363 179 44343822685
2083 732822503 1080749145
All about undefined
Interested in learning more?
03416603363 179 44343822685
2083 732822503 1080749145
See more
782431 1747383607
2904 3375056 5001 88 58399
See more
0816 49080
98629 79 098050 95785695568
See more